トピック このトピックは解決済みです
TOPIC 検索結果詳細表示について
Posted by あいと
at 2010/01/13(水) 17:23
分類: 新規設置トラブル

こんにちは、以前IISでの設置について質問をさせていただいたものです。以前はありがとうございました。
また引っかかってしまったところがありましたので、解決の糸口など、ご教授ください。

検索結果や管理者画面の「データ一覧」で詳細表示に飛ぼうとすると
以下の表示が出て、詳細表示に飛ぶことができません。

Location: http://localhost/cgi/database/database.cgi?cmd=dp&num=2&dp=

少しでもヒントになるようなことがあれば、ぜひお願いいたします。

編集: 2010/01/19(火) 04:05
トピック このトピックは解決済みです
レス表示 古い順 新しい順 | 3件のレス 1-3 表示中
RES レスメッセージ
Posted by Bear
at 2010/01/15(金) 12:19
Re:検索結果詳細表示について
> No3727への引用返信
> こんにちは、以前IISでの設置について質問をさせていただいたものです。以前はありがとうございました。
> また引っかかってしまったところがありましたので、解決の糸口など、ご教授ください。
>
> 検索結果や管理者画面の「データ一覧」で詳細表示に飛ぼうとすると
> 以下の表示が出て、詳細表示に飛ぶことができません。
>
> Location: http://localhost/cgi/database/database.cgi?cmd=dp&num=2&dp=
>
> 少しでもヒントになるようなことがあれば、ぜひお願いいたします。

こんにちは。
AmigoDatabaseではLocation転送はdatabase.cgiのLocationサブルーチンにて行われていますが、その記述は
print"Location: $url\n\n";
となります。
ご質問の問題は単に「Location」が認識されずprintされているものと思われます。IISではLocationの扱いはどうなっているのでしょうか?
Posted by Bear
at 2010/01/15(金) 12:23
Re:検索結果詳細表示について
少し調べてみましたがIISの場合
print "Content-type: text/html\n";
の記述が必要なのかもしれませんね。
database.cgiのLocationサブル-チン内に追加してみてお試し下さい。
print "Content-type: text/html\n";
print"Location: $url\n\n";
Posted by あいと
at 2010/01/16(土) 05:11
Re:検索結果詳細表示について
> No3729への引用返信
> 少し調べてみましたがIISの場合
> print "Content-type: text/html\n";
> の記述が必要なのかもしれませんね。
> database.cgiのLocationサブル-チン内に追加してみてお試し下さい。
> print "Content-type: text/html\n";
> print"Location: $url\n\n";
Bear様

ご教授ありがとうございます。
書き込みいただいたの方法では同じ表示が出てしまうのですが、それをヒントに探っていったところ、Locationが扱えないっぽいのでsetupでmetaに切り替え、、db-j.cgiにprint("HTTP/1.0 200 OK\n");を付け加えたところ、うまく表示することが出来ました。

どこに手をつけて良いかわからず諦めかけておりましたが、なんとか設置を終了することが出来そうです。
ありがとうございました。
Access: 1,209,895
 
ソーシャルブックマーク: Yahoo!ブックマーク Google Bookmarks はてなブックマーク Livedoorクリップ @niftyクリップ FC2ブックマーク Buzzurl Delicious トピックイット newsing it!